Composite decking is a strong player in the world of outdoor spaces. It blends recycled plastic and old timber for a look that mimics natural wood. This mix makes it firm, safe from splinters, and suitable against slips.

So, it’s great for kids and pets who love to run around barefoot! In Devonport, many houses use composite decking because it lasts long.

Cutting-Edge Co-extrusion Decking

We offer the latest co-extrusion decking. This type of decking has a solid outer layer. It makes decks more challenging and long-lasting. This top layer also fights against stains, so your deck looks new for years.

Our co-extrusion decking is safe, too. There are no sharp wood bits that can hurt bare feet or pets.

Some More Details About East Devonport – TAS 7310

East Devonport, nestled along the northern coast of Tasmania, exudes a serene coastal charm complemented by convenient urban amenities. This suburb boasts picturesque views of the Bass Strait and features a blend of residential areas, offering a relaxed residential lifestyle.
